A visit to the defending champs...I love this ballpark...Don't think I have been here since like 2005 or something like that though...Both teams are starting to take shape...Big ups to the Joliet staff for hooking me up with some food in the Hall of Fame room downstairs...Num num num..We will see if Jamie Bennett decides to make changes today or, if like yesterday, he lets the majority of his lineup play...

I had my first extended convo with the Skipper today and he said for the most part that the lineups have just been based on what will get guys at bats and will not necessarily look that way during the season, though I suspect that the Hall-Pfister 3-4 combo may not change...Jamie was also mentioning to me that it will be good to get under the lights tonight since afterall probably five of every six games will be at night...This is just the second night contest of the exhibition slate...Exhibition schedule wraps up tomorrow at Windy City in a 2:00 p.m. affair...

Joliet was rained out again this weekend so the Slammers have played only one other game since seeing Schaumburg on Friday...The Slammers open the regular season on Thursday with a single game at Windy City before three games at Gateway this weekend...Home opener and ring ceremony is on Tuesday, May 22 against Traverse City...
